Grigny : Early childhood
Tailor-made supportThe Learning Planet Institute is collaborating with the town of Grigny and its Early Childhood Department to design and implement a new transitional system for children under the age of three between the nursery and school.
This project mobilizes several levers for action: co-constructing the system with all the players involved, and reinforcing educational content.

WasiLab
Promoting sustainability science in EcuadorLearning Planet Institute supports the Pontifical Catholic University of Ecuador (PUCE) in its WasiLab project.
This initiative is an essential pillar of PUCE's ecological transformation program.
In partnership with renowned players such as the Institut de Recherche pour le Développement (IRD) and France Volontaires, we work together to encourage the emergence of sustainable, innovative projects.

Learning Transitions Research Unit (UR LT)
Research projects supporting the SDGsJointly led by CY Cergy Paris Université and the Learning Planet Institute, the Research Unit aims to develop scientific theories, methods and tools to address learning transitions. Its work draws on interdisciplinarity, citizen science, collective intelligence and AI to respond to today’s and tomorrow’s challenges.
